Public Transport Route Recommender Regarding Multiple Factors

Description
Public transport route recommendation is a complex problem because passengers take many factors into consideration while planning their trips. In this paper, a novel route recommending approach is proposed to find the ideal public transport route with respect to multiple factors such that number of transfers, total distance, and walking distance (in the order of importance). Space P modelling technique and a Dijkstra's Algorithm based method are applied together for the first time by this approach. The proposed method is tested on the real-world dataset (Public Transport Network of Izmir, Turkey) having 7,704 stations and 43,467 connections between these stations. In the experimental results, it is clearly seen that our method finds the optimal route regarding the specified factors for each given destination in milliseconds.
